Brompton Split Banc (TSE:SBC) Reaches New 52-Week High – Time to Buy?

Brompton Split Banc Corp. (TSE:SBCGet Free Report)’s stock price hit a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Thursday . The stock traded as high as C$10.25 and last traded at C$10.24, with a volume of 25584 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$10.09.

Brompton Split Banc Trading Up 0.2 %

The firm has a market cap of C$224.99 million, a P/E ratio of 11.92 and a beta of 1.51. The firm has a fifty day simple moving average of C$9.49 and a 200-day simple moving average of C$9.13.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 126.70, a current ratio of 1.77 and a quick ratio of 1.94.

Insider Buying and Selling

In other Brompton Split Banc news, Director Brompton Corp. sold 8,400 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Wednesday, August 7th. The shares were sold at an average price of C$10.25, for a total transaction of C$86,100.00. Insiders have sold a total of 24,519 shares of company stock worth $252,351 in the last ninety days.

Brompton Split Banc Corp. is a close-ended equity mutual fund launched and managed by Brompton Funds Limited. The fund invests in the public equity markets of Canada. It seeks to invest in stocks of companies primarily engaged in the banking sector. The fund benchmarks the performance of its portfolio against the S&P/TSX Capped Financials Index.
